Job summary
The Colne Practice, located in Rickmansworth, is seeking an experienced practice nurse to join their busy practice,preferably with a respiratory interest (asthma, COPD, spirometry).This position is offered on apart-time basis, for 2 days per week,working a Thursday and a Friday. GP practice experience is essential. Working as a member of the multidisciplinary team, the successful individual will ensure nursing services are delivered effectively to the entitled patient population and implement processes for the management of patients with long-term conditions.
Main duties of the job
Asthma, COPD, spirometry Diagnose and manage acute and chronic conditions Provide wound care (ulcer/Doppler, etc.) to patients Develop, implement and embed an effective care management programme for the frail and housebound patients registered at the practice Assess the needs of patients ensuring the provision of healthcare is appropriate, incorporating evidence-based practice. Develop, implement and embed health promotion and wellbeing programmes Implement and evaluate individual treatment plans for chronic disease patients that promote health and wellbeing Identify, manage and support patients at risk of developing long-term conditions, preventing adverse effects to patients health
About us
The Colne Practice is a friendly GP practice with a list size of approximately 10,500 patients. Our team comprises 7 GP partners, 2 practice nurses, 1 HCA, 2 clinical pharmacists and reception and admin teams.We have on site staff parking.

Person Specification
Qualifications Essential
A relevant nursing degree. Current NMC registration with an active PIN.
Desirable
Mentor or teaching qualification. Post graduate diploma or degree (CDM).
Experience Essential
Experience of working within a primary care environment. This is essential: please do not apply if you don't have GP practice experience. Experience of working autonomously. Experience of infection control measures. Clinical knowledge including; ECGs, venepuncture, wound care, women's health.
Desirable
Experience of working as a practice or community nurse.
